Independent safety assessment (ISA)
Independent safety assessment involves making a judgement against a set of requirements about the safety adequacy of a product, system or process in a particular context and environment. It may require demonstration of compliance to recognised standards but for specific situations full compliance may not be necessary.

Major project assurance
Governments and other stakeholders often wish to gain assurance that a large and complex system, like a new railway, meets appropriate requirements for issues such as safety, RAM, operability and performance. As well as Independent Safety Assessment (ISA) and statutory certification activities, there is a need for one body to take an overview of the whole system.

Notified body
Notified Bodies are appointed by members of the European Union to carry out conformity assessment against European Directive 2008/57.

Entities in Charge of Maintenance
If you are an assigned entity in charge of maintenance (ECM) for freight wagons you will need to obtain an ECM certificate from a certification body by 31 May 2012.
